The Gift That I Can Give

by Kathie Lee Gifford

First published 2018

A young child turns to God with a heartfelt question: what gift can I give to make the world better? The child doesn't want to wait until growing up to make a difference. Through prayer and reflection, they discover that meaningful gifts come in many forms. Being kind to others counts as a gift. Giving family members extra hugs brightens their day. Visiting sick people brings comfort. Cheering for friends shows support. The child learns that age and size don't determine the value of what someone can offer. Every person, no matter how young or small, possesses something special to share. The story follows this journey of discovery as the child realizes that making the world better starts with simple, loving actions today. Faith guides the child toward understanding that God has already placed unique gifts within them, waiting to be shared with those around them.
